Chris M. Lehr,

CFP® Financial Advisor

Chris Lehr has built his practice by delivering outstanding service, sound advice and customized financial plans for his clients. He grows his client relationships based upon trust, integrity and a commitment to place their needs first in all circumstances.

Chris’ career as a Financial Advisor was largely driven by his awareness of the great need in the community for people to receive sound financial guidance to help them realize their goals. Joining this awareness with his own passion for financial planning led him to choose a profession where he could serve others by helping them to plan well for a more prosperous future.

A 1986 graduate of Penn State University, Chris later studied at Kaplan University where he received certification in Financial Planning. In 2007 he was awarded the C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ER certification from the Certified Financial Planner Board of Standards. He joined Raymond James in 1999 and has nearly 30 years’ experience helping people with their finances. He holds 63, 65, and 7 securities licenses, and he is also licensed to give advice and counsel with life, disability and long-term care insurances.
